Explanation — risks and areas to improve

Without HSTS, downgrade and man‑in‑the‑middle attacks can weaken HTTPS enforcement. Enable HSTS and prepare for preload registration.

Missing key security headers leaves the site vulnerable to clickjacking, MIME sniffing, and data leakage.

Without DNSSEC, trust relies solely on parent name servers and DNS tampering risks can be higher in some environments.

Without MTA‑STS, SMTP TLS enforcement is weaker.

Without TLS‑RPT, it is harder to collect TLS failure signals and operational insight.

Without security.txt, the vulnerability disclosure channel is unclear and response may be delayed.

Cookies without Secure / HttpOnly / SameSite can be vulnerable to theft or session fixation attacks.
